Ruby Console opens automatically on startup
Hello,
for several days now the ruby console opens automatically on Startup (Sketchup Make 2016). This is not really a problem, but it is kind of annoying, and I don't know why this is happening and how to make it stop. When I close it it simply reappears the next time I start Sketchup.
I don't know if it could be because of an extension, but I haven't really added many lately and I already tried disabling them...
Does anyone have an idea why this could be happening and what I could do about it?

[REQ] Edge/Line from Midpoint
If there already is such a plugin, I was not able to find it, but I just today thought it would be great to have a line tool that would allow drawing lines from the midpoint - so you start at a point and when drawing the line in one direction from it, it gets simultaneously extended in the exact opposite direction with the same length so that the start point becomes the midpoint.
Fredo's "Tools on Surface" can do something like this for rectangle edges, but I would like to have it just for lines and, of course, not only on surfaces.
If there is such a plugin already, please tell me! It seems like such a simple and obvious idea that I'd be surprised if nobody had done it, yet.
